You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@commons.apache.org by si...@apache.org on 2011/05/30 10:35:52 UTC

svn commit: r1129057 - /commons/sandbox/digester3/trunk/src/main/java/org/apache/commons/digester3/plugins/strategies/LoaderFromStream.java

Author: simonetripodi
Date: Mon May 30 08:35:52 2011
New Revision: 1129057

URL: http://svn.apache.org/viewvc?rev=1129057&view=rev
Log:
no needs to store the RuleSet reference, create&set in one-shot

Modified:
    commons/sandbox/digester3/trunk/src/main/java/org/apache/commons/digester3/plugins/strategies/LoaderFromStream.java

Modified: commons/sandbox/digester3/trunk/src/main/java/org/apache/commons/digester3/plugins/strategies/LoaderFromStream.java
URL: http://svn.apache.org/viewvc/commons/sandbox/digester3/trunk/src/main/java/org/apache/commons/digester3/plugins/strategies/LoaderFromStream.java?rev=1129057&r1=1129056&r2=1129057&view=diff
==============================================================================
--- commons/sandbox/digester3/trunk/src/main/java/org/apache/commons/digester3/plugins/strategies/LoaderFromStream.java (original)
+++ commons/sandbox/digester3/trunk/src/main/java/org/apache/commons/digester3/plugins/strategies/LoaderFromStream.java Mon May 30 08:35:52 2011
@@ -27,7 +27,6 @@ import java.io.IOException;
 import java.io.InputStream;
 
 import org.apache.commons.digester3.Digester;
-import org.apache.commons.digester3.RuleSet;
 import org.apache.commons.digester3.plugins.PluginException;
 import org.apache.commons.digester3.plugins.RuleLoader;
 import org.apache.commons.digester3.xmlrules.FromXmlRulesModule;
@@ -95,7 +94,7 @@ public class LoaderFromStream
         // caching the input data in memory anyway.
 
         final InputSource source = new InputSource( new ByteArrayInputStream( input ) );
-        RuleSet ruleSet = newLoader( new FromXmlRulesModule()
+        newLoader( new FromXmlRulesModule()
         {
 
             @Override
@@ -105,8 +104,7 @@ public class LoaderFromStream
                 loadXMLRules( source );
             }
 
-        }).createRuleSet();
-        ruleSet.addRuleInstances( d );
+        }).createRuleSet().addRuleInstances( d );
     }
 
 }